To:                                           Board of Supervisors

From:                                           Warren Lai, Public Works Director/Chief Engineer

Report Title:                     Termination of County’s interest in Excess Road Right of Way on Bernhard Avenue, Richmond area.

Recommendation of the County Administrator Recommendation of Board Committee

 

RECOMMENDATIONS:

DETERMINE that the offer of dedication on Bernhard Avenue for road (highway) purposes is not required for County road (highway) purposes.

 

ADOPT Resolution to terminate and abandon an offer of dedication of excess right of way on Bernhard Avenue in Richmond which is described in Exhibit A and Exhibit B attached to the Resolution and is no longer required for street or highway purposes pursuant to Streets and Highway Code section and 8334(a) and Government Code section 66477.2(2).

 

AUTHORIZE the Public Works Director, or designee, to execute and deliver a quitclaim deed to the underlying property owner of APN 418-061-011for recording in the Office of the County Clerk-Recorder, to quitclaim any remaining interest of the County in the dedication area pursuant to Streets and Highway Code section 960 and Government Code section 25526.5.

 

DETERMINE that the activity is not subject to the California Environmental Quality Act (CEQA), pursuant to Article 5, Section 15061(b)(3) of the CEQA Guidelines as it can be seen with certainty that there is no possibility that the activity may have a significant effect on the environment,

 

DIRECT the Real Estate Division to record the above referenced Resolution, along with a certified copy of this Staff Report in the Office of the County Clerk-Recorder.

 

FISCAL IMPACT:

100% Applicant Fees.

 

BACKGROUND:

Public Works staff have determined that (1) the excess right-of-way being vacated and quitclaimed on Bernhard Avenue has not been accepted by the County, (2) the offered area is not required, and will not be used for the purpose for which it was dedicated.

 

The Applicant is requesting the excess road right-of-way be vacated and quitclaimed and to formally clarify that the Offer of Dedication will not be enacted. The Board’s actions will expressly terminate and abandon the offer of dedication and remove the County’s interest from the title to the underlying property. Any future development or use of the Property will be subject to further review under CEQA.

 

CONSEQUENCE OF NEGATIVE ACTION:

The County will not expressly terminate and abandon the offer of dedication.
